Dr Rupali Dutta from Fortis Hospitals is out of touch with the latest advances in nutritional science.

She recommends that diabetics should eat less eggs. This is wrong. Diabetics should be told to eat less carbohydrates (grains, potatoes and sugar).

Eggs have practically zero glycaemic load, and are healthy, nutritious additions to the diet of a diabetic. Diabetics should be encouraged to eat a couple of eggs every day!

Dr Dutta also draws a link between dietary cholesterol and cholesterol in the blood. This is an outdated notion. Dietary cholesterol limits have already been removed by the American Heart Association from their recommendations. The limit on egg consumption, as well as the recommendation to eat egg whites, is old hat, and is not nutritional science. It now firmly belongs in the nutritional superstition bucket!
